A nexus between air pollution, energy consumption and growth of economy: A comparative study between the USA and China-based on the ARDL bound testing approach

The aim of the study is to investigate and compare the correlation between energy consumption, air pollution and economic growth in China and the USA. Both countries are powerful economic countries in the world, thus we attempt to know whether energy consumption and air pollution vary as the economy develops. The data for the research spanning from 1970 to 2014 was gathered from an indicator of the World Bank. The time span was decided due to the data availability of both countries. To examine the long-run equilibrium relationship, there was performed the ARDL bound test. Results of unit root indicated that all the variables were integrated of order one. In the case of the ARDL bound test, the values of F-statistics exceeded the upper bound value, which means they are statistically significant. The estimation results substantiated the positive coefficient of energy consumption at the 1% significance level in China, implying that air pollution can increase as the energy consumption rises in China. However, the empirical results of the USA were exactly on the contrary. The outcomes of the CUSUM and CUSUMSQ tests revealed that all coefficients in both the short- and long-run models were stable. Based on the above analysis, the study suggests that China should adopt innovation and environmentally friendly modern technologies. Specifically, China ought to inspire and motivate energy saving and low-carbon research innovations, energy saving industries, green investment and carbon sequester technologies as well as public environmental awareness creations to mitigate environmental deterioration and climate change.
